Electronic Systems Architect
Paccar
- Lewisville, TX
- Permanent
- Full-time
- Design electrical and electronic systems, in-vehicle network communication, and architecture for next-generation heavy-duty vehicles.
- Analyze system needs and requirements and create system architecture designs.
- Participate in Function Scrums to collaborate on system design details.
- Integrate a variety of subsystems into vehicle electrical/electronic network architecture.
- Develop and document engineering specifications for new vehicle control functions, including Advanced Driver Assistance Systems (ADAS) and Battery Electric Hybrid components.
- Support test organization in the identification and resolution of design issues. Update architecture documents accordingly.
- Peer review coworker design documents, as well as provide review feedback to input documents and software requirements.
- Manage engineering and project processes to maintain schedule, budget, and function.
- Learn and develop Technical Safety Concepts for systems requiring Automotive Safety Integrity Level
